Director Joseph W. Carroll of Norwood Financial Corp (NASDAQ:NWFL) completed a personal purchase of 2,000 shares of the company's common stock on January 27, 2026. The shares were acquired at a per-share price of $27.91, bringing the total cost of the transaction to $55,820.
Following this purchase, Carroll's direct holdings in Norwood Financial total 37,503 shares. The filing also lists indirect holdings attributed to family and retirement accounts: 7,247 shares by spouse, 724 shares by IRA, and 724 shares by Sposue IRA.
Earnings backdrop
Norwood Financial reported what the company described as significant growth in its fourth-quarter 2025 earnings. Management highlighted a substantial rise in net interest income, which materially contributed to more than doubling both adjusted earnings per share and adjusted net income for the period.
According to the company statement, the quarter's performance was supported by an acquisition that broadened Norwood Financial's market footprint. The company characterized the results as marking a strong finish to its fiscal year.
